PLEASE HELP!!! WHAT IS THE SLOPE OF THE LINE X=4?

Mathematics
2 answers:
NeTakaya3 years ago
7 0
Hello!

Slope-intercept form uses the following formula:

y = mx + b

In this case, "m" represents the slope while "b" represents the y-intercept. The given equation, however, does not contain both variable X and Y. It simply states (x = 4). Consequently, this equation does not have a y-intercept. It gives only the x-value, which is always equal to 4. Therefore, it can be concluded that the line representing (x = 4) is a vertical line intercepting the x-axis at point (4,0).

Vertical lines do not have a slope and are considered to be undefined.
